  • Individuals who repeatedly park in client and reserved stalls without the proper permit, have expired meters, or fail to pay for parking in the garage will face escalating fines that will increase over time. Simply paying the same fine for each violation will no longer be an option. Repeat offenders will incur higher penalties. Fines for parking in client and reserved stalls will begin at $55 and can escalate to a maximum of $220 if not paid. Similarly, fines for expired meters and non-payment of garage fees will start at $20 and may rise to a maximum of $160 if left unpaid.
  • The Manhattan campus has upgraded its parking meters to accept cashless payments, allowing users to pay with credit and debit cards. This modernization eliminates the need for coins and offers digital payment options, including tap-to-pay functionality.

Parking Permits

Students, faculty and staff can order a permit in the Parking Portal. Please be sure to have your vehicle make, model and license plate number ready when ordering. Students must be enrolled and have their housing arrangements before they order a permit. A confirmation email is sent after the online process is completed.
